Asper alumna distinguished as a Canada Climate Champion in lead up to 2021 United Nations COP26
May 28, 2021 —
Asper alumna Jennifer McNeill [BSc/95, MBA/06] has been named one of 26 Climate Champions across Canada in preparation for the 2021 United Nations Climate Change Conference of the Parties (COP26). McNeill is the Vice-President of Public Sector Sales and Marketing at New Flyer and MCI, a leading independent bus coach manufacturer leading the evolution in zero-emission mobility.

Asper Assistant Professor published in the Journal of Financial Economics
May 13, 2021 —
Dr. Zhenzhen Fan, an Assistant Professor in Finance and Economics at the Asper School of Business recently learned that her paper entitled, Equity Trail Risk and Currency Risk Premiums was accepted for publication by Journal of Financial Economics (JFE), a leading peer-reviewed academic journal covering theoretical and empirical topics in financial economics. Dr. Fan co-authored this paper along with Dr. Juan M. Londono, Senior Economic Project Manager of the US Board of Governors of the Federal Reserve System, and Dr. Xiao Xiao, Assistant Professor of Finance at Amsterdam Business School, University of Amsterdam.
